A blockchain explorer is similar to a search engine. It provides all the details regarding a particular blockchain including the transactions, address, amount transferred, and the fees paid. It allows you to find the history of all the transactions made on a particular address in a blockchain.
Below are some of the widely used blockchain explorers.
- Blockchain.com
Blockchain.com is one of the most efficient blockchain explorers currently available. It has an easily accessible and user-friendly interface to navigate through blockchain networks. Blockchain.com also provides consistent regular graph updation for free, transaction monitor and checker, mining difficulty, bitcoin transaction tracker, current hash rate, transaction monitor, block checker, etc.
Users can also switch between Ethereum Cash or Bitcoin analysis. Blockchain.com was the first blockchain explorer of its kind. Most people are very familiar with it, making it extremely popular among blockchain users.
- Tokenview
Tokenview offers a lot of beneficial features and an exceptional feature of multi-chain research. It was created by a Chinese development team and initially targeted the Chinese market therefore, users may find it difficult to use the English language on the site. Tokenview supports more than 100 cryptocurrencies, making it an ideal multi-chain explorer.
It features robust navigation tools to find daily trading levels, block winners, active Bitcoin wallet addresses daily, etc. Tokenview also helps you to learn the blockchains of many cryptocurrencies including Ethereum, NEO, Litecoin, TRON, ZCash, Ontology, and Monero.
